Searched refs:VRegAllowed (Results 1 - 1 of 1) sorted by relevance

/freebsd-current/contrib/llvm-project/llvm/lib/CodeGen/
H A DRegAllocPBQP.cpp624 std::vector<MCRegister> VRegAllowed; local
647 VRegAllowed.push_back(PReg);
652 if (VRegAllowed.empty()) {
659 VRegAllowedMap[VReg.id()] = std::move(VRegAllowed);
672 auto &VRegAllowed = KV.second; local
674 PBQPRAGraph::RawVector NodeCosts(VRegAllowed.size() + 1, 0);
678 for (unsigned i = 0; i != VRegAllowed.size(); ++i)
679 if (isACalleeSavedRegister(VRegAllowed[i], TRI, MF))
685 G.getMetadata().getAllowedRegs(std::move(VRegAllowed)));

Completed in 177 milliseconds